In all my years of driving, I've frequently used the '2x' function on the key fob, which refers to double-clicking that button. For example, in my car, pressing the unlock button once only unlocks the driver's door, while pressing it twice unlocks all doors – a clever design to prevent sudden break-ins in parking lots. Another example is the trunk button: a single press puts it in standby mode, and a double press actually opens it. I've also found this feature particularly useful in rainy or snowy weather, eliminating the rush to find the mechanical key. Over time, I've developed the habit of lightly pressing buttons twice, as smooth operation helps avoid accidental actions. Additionally, settings may vary slightly between different car models, but the core purpose remains enhancing safety and convenience. I recommend checking the vehicle manual or settings for customization options.

When using the car key, understand the '2x' function. Double-clicking a button, such as the trunk release, requires a first press to prepare and a second press to execute. This prevents accidental openings and ensures safety. I once saw someone accidentally trigger the key while parking, resulting in an unlocked car and stolen belongings. It's advisable to always lightly press twice to confirm the response, especially in dimly lit areas like underground garages. If the response seems slow, check the battery life or sources of signal interference. Safe driving starts with attention to detail.

What are the differences between the New Bora and Bora Legend?

New Bora and Bora Legend mainly differ in terms of body structure, exterior design, and configurations. The Bora Legend is built on the PQ34 platform, while the new Bora is based on the MQB platform. The exterior design of the Bora Legend is not significantly different from the current Bora model, but the new Bora, built on the MQB platform, features some subtle changes in details. Below is an introduction to the Bora Legend: 1. Configurations: The Bora Legend comes standard with features such as Electronic Stability Program (ESP),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S), Cruise Control, and a 2.5 High-Efficiency Air Filter. Additionally, it is equipped with a liquid crystal display, sunroof, multifunction steering wheel, and rearview camera. 2. Powertrain: The Bora Legend is powered by an EA211 series 1.5L naturally aspirated engine, with a maximum power output of 81kW and a maximum torque of 150Nm. It is paired with either a 5-speed manual transmission or a 6-speed automatic transmission.

What is the general speed limit in highway tunnels?

Highway tunnels typically have a speed limit of 60 to 80 kilometers per hour. Lane changing and overtaking are prohibited in tunnels due to limited space and poor lighting conditions, which can easily disrupt normal traffic flow. Moreover, most tunnels are equipped with comprehensive camera surveillance systems. Illegal lane changes will result in a 3-point penalty and a fine of 150 yuan. Below are precautions for driving in tunnels: 1. When drivers see they are approaching a tunnel, they should check the speed limit signs on both sides of the road in advance. If using navigation, it usually provides early warnings about tunnel speed limits, at which point drivers should slow down and maintain a safe distance from vehicles ahead. 2. Before entering a tunnel, drivers must turn on their headlights and keep them on until completely exiting the tunnel. The sudden darkness upon entering can cause temporary visual impairment as eyes struggle to adapt to the abrupt change in lighting. Turning on headlights beforehand helps mitigate this visual shock. 3. Lane changing, U-turns, and tailgating are prohibited in tunnels. When exiting, drivers should gradually reduce speed to allow their eyes to adjust to the bright outdoor light. Conspicuous warning signs are posted above or beside tunnel entrances—drivers must strictly follow regulations as all tunnels have 24/7 video surveillance with zero tolerance for violations.

What engine does the Honda Jade use?

The Honda Jade is equipped with two types of engines: a 1.8-liter naturally aspirated engine with a maximum power of 104 kW and a maximum torque of 174 Nm, and a 1.5-liter turbocharged engine with 156 horsepower, a maximum torque of 203 Nm, and a maximum torque range of 1600 to 5000 rpm. The Honda Jade is a compact hatchback model under the Honda brand, with dimensions of 4660mm in length, 1775mm in width, and 1500mm in height, and a wheelbase of 2760mm. The vehicle is equipped with the Honda SENSING safety system, which integrates the ACC active cruise control system, RDM lane departure mitigation system, TSR traffic sign recognition system, and LWC blind spot display system.

How to Judge the Distance of Vehicles Behind Using Car Rearview Mirrors?

Methods to judge the distance of vehicles behind using car rearview mirrors are: 1. Adjust the rearview mirrors properly, with the standard for both side mirrors being able to see the door handles of your own rear doors, and the height of the door handles should be at the middle of the mirrors; 2. If the vehicle behind is in the safe zone and positioned at the center of the rearview mirror, it indicates a distance of approximately 15 to 20 meters from the vehicle behind, allowing normal turning operations; 3. If the vehicle behind occupies half of the rearview mirror area and only half of the vehicle body is visible, it means the distance is very close, and you should maintain your current lane without turning; 4. If the vehicle behind occupies half of the rearview mirror area but the entire vehicle is visible, it indicates a distance of about 10 meters, and you can signal and turn when driving at a slower speed.
